Transaction f59f7e56305d9177415d642e33a47b91af3738be8b65c500b9a872cbf453f93d
2 Input
1 Outputs
- f59f7e56305d9177415d642e33a47b91af3738be8b65c500b9a872cbf453f93d:0
value 42250
address 3Pmp6zUpbasTKLnL3RcroRhe9pFHNF2WGm